About the volunteering opportunity

Encounters between people strengthen cohesion in our diverse immigration society. Starting out in a new country is also easier with friends. That's why we've been bringing together newcomers who are starting out in Germany and locals who have been living in your city for some time - since 2014. We call this Tandem. They often become friends.

You decide what you do together. The shared experiences are as diverse as the participants at SwaF. Some tandems share their different experiences, cook together, learn languages together, explore the city, art and culture. Others go to the authorities or meet up with other friends. They come to the SwaF community events together.

Your Tasks

If you would like to get involved with Tandem, you can become a mediator. As a facilitator, you organize information evenings and tell people about SwaF Tandem. You will try to recruit new participants for tandems. This means that at the beginning we get to know everyone personally, look for common interests and life circumstances and trust our gut feeling. We send the participants an email with an initial tandem proposal. You will accompany the tandems for the first 6 months. This means you are the contact person for the tandem participants.

What's needed

For this volunteering opportunity, advanced German skills are required.

To become a mediator, it is important that you want to meet new people. If you are curious and empathetic, this will help a lot. You also need enough time to be able to accompany the Tandem participants. You should be able to set aside around 2 - 3 hours a week for volunteering. As communication within the team takes place in German, you need a good knowledge of German. If you also speak other languages, this can be a great help.

Start with a Friend e.V.

Start with a Friend connects immigrants and locals in tandems based on interests and needs. Ideally, a friendship develops out of this, but in any case, a social network is created that makes it easier for immigrants to have a good start in Germany. Start with a Friend accompanies and advises the tandems after the matching and organises events to bring the tandems into contact with each other. It is also important to us to create structures in which people can get involved, even if they are tied up in their work and family life. The time schedule is therefore flexible; further training courses are offered but are optional. So far, Start with a Friend is available in 21 cities nationwide.
